Abstract

The utility model provides a palm type electric brush utensil, this electric brush utensil includes shell, motor and brush body, its characterized in that, this electric brush utensil includes the shell that the whole parcel of a suitable staff palm was lived, embeds motor, dry battery and transmission in this shell, and transmission connects and drives the brush body through a brush body pivot. The utility model relates to a palm-type electric brush, which comprises a shell, a built-in motor and a driving device, wherein the shell is slightly larger than a mouse and is suitable for the whole hand to wrap and hold; the brush body is driven to rotate by the driving device, and cleaning, polishing and waxing actions are completed. The electric brush has the advantages of small overall structure, light weight, simple and labor-saving operation and good practicability, and is suitable for being mastered by a single hand to operate.

Description

Palm type electric brush
[ technical field ] A method for producing a semiconductor device
The utility model relates to a small-size domestic electronic product especially relates to motor drive's palm type brush utensil.
[ background of the invention ]
The brush washing tool used in daily life of a family is generally the most original brush driven by manpower, and the use of the brush washing tool is very laborious, the efficiency is not high, and the brushing effect is general. There are also some electric brushes or brushes, which generally have a long handle and a motor with a large volume, and the self-weight of the brush or brush is not light, and the brush or brush does not need to swing back and forth to brush the animal in the using process, but only the electric appliance is held and kept balanced and stable under the condition that the motor rotates, and the brush or brush is quite laborious. When small appliances are washed or articles are waxed and polished, the small appliances are not suitable for use or are inconvenient to use.
[ summary of the invention ]
The utility model discloses have proposed palm type electric brush utensil to above problem, this electric brush utensil uses its shell as the part of taking, and driver part and the miniature design of drive disk assembly optimization, the small and exquisite quality of overall structure alleviates by a wide margin, is fit for operating personnel and directly holds and take convenient to use laborsaving.
A palm-type electric brush is composed of casing, motor and brush body, and features that it has an internal motor, dry battery and driver, which is connected to brush body via a pivot.
The switch is arranged on the side face of the shell and connected with a switch circuit arranged in the shell, and the switch circuit controls the dry battery and the motor.
The transmission device is a transmission gear, and the transmission gear comprises a multi-stage speed reduction and torque increasing transmission gear.
The driven wheel drives a brush body rotating shaft, and the brush body rotating shaft is coaxial with the driven wheel.
The bottom of the shell is provided with a rotating shaft hole, and the rotating shaft of the brush body extends out of the shell from the inside of the shell through the rotating shaft hole to drive the brush body.
A waterproof rubber ring is arranged at the rotating shaft hole of the shell.
The top of the shell is provided with a plurality of strip-shaped bulges suitable for finger slots or a fixing ring suitable for fingers to penetrate.
The utility model relates to a palm-type electric brush, which comprises a shell, a built-in motor and a driving device, wherein the shell is slightly larger than a mouse and is suitable for the whole body of a single palm to be wrapped and grasped; the brush body is driven to rotate by the driving device, and cleaning, polishing and waxing actions are completed. The electric brush has the advantages of small overall structure, light weight, simple and labor-saving operation and good practicability, and is suitable for being mastered by one hand to operate.

Referring to fig. 1, there is shown a palm-type electric brush having a housing 10 sized as a mouse to fit the entire hand of a human hand in a wrapping manner, a motor 20, a transmission 30 and a dry battery 40 provided in the housing 10, and a brush body 50 provided outside the housing 10. The housing 10 houses the motor 20, the dry battery 40, and the actuator 30 is connected to and drives the brush 50 through a brush rotating shaft 33.
A switch 11 is provided on the side of the housing 10, and the switch 11 is connected to a switch circuit built in the housing, and the switch circuit controls the dry battery 40 and the motor 20. The motor is controlled to start and stop by the switch.
The transmission device 30 is a transmission gear, and the transmission gear comprises a multi-stage speed reduction and torque increase transmission gear.
The motor 20 is engaged with the driving wheel 31 in the transmission gear through the self-provided gear, the driving wheel 31 drives the driven wheel 32 through transmission engagement, the driving wheel with less teeth drives the driven wheel with more teeth, the rotating speed of the driven wheel is reduced, and meanwhile the torque of the driven wheel is increased.
The driven pulley 32 drives a brush body rotation shaft 33, and the brush body rotation shaft 33 is coaxial with the driven pulley 32.
A rotating shaft hole 12 is formed at the bottom of the housing 10, and the brush body rotating shaft 33 extends out of the housing 10 through the rotating shaft hole 12 from the inside of the housing to drive the brush body 50. The part of the brush body rotating shaft 33 needs to extend from the inside of the shell 10 to the outside of the shell 10, and the shell 10 needs to be provided with a rotating shaft hole 12 for the brush body rotating shaft 33 to pass through, and the part needs to be designed to be waterproof, so that the brush body rotating shaft 33 can pass through, the brush body rotating shaft 33 can rotate, and meanwhile, the waterproof effect is realized.
A waterproof rubber ring is arranged at the rotating shaft hole 12 of the shell 10.
A holding aid 13 is provided at the top of the housing for holding or supporting the palm of a hand.
It is also possible, as in fig. 2 and 3, to dispense with the design of the holding aid, but to provide the housing at the top with a plurality of strip-shaped projections 14 adapted to the finger-joint or fastening rings 15 adapted to the finger-penetration. Are intended to facilitate the grasping and bearing forces imparted by the user while holding the tool.
